North Perth Veterinary Centre is a trusted veterinary clinic dedicated to providing exceptional, personalized care for pets of all ages. Our experienced team, including Dr. Lucy, Dr. Lou, Dr. Pip, and skilled nurses, offers compassionate and detailed medical services, from routine check-ups to complex procedures. We prioritize clear communication, gentle handling, and tailored treatment plans to ensure your pet's health and your peace of mind. Located at 213 Walcott St, we serve the North Perth community with a commitment to building lasting relationships with pets and their families.

For reasons we can only imagine, our 13 year old Staffy Denny decided to take up a new hobby this weekend: eating sand … following a night in the ED with little change, we called North Perth Veterinary Centre to get Denny an urgent appointment. Upon answering the call, Pip and the team were already aware of Denny’s ED visit and anticipating our visit (truth be told, I think we only just beat them to the phone…). They fit Denny in for an appointment first thing and kept him in all day for fluids, tests, and pain relief. Under normal circumstances, our boy is first in first out as he is a certifiable PITA when it comes to sooking. Despite this, Pip and the team kept him comfortable, even taking turns sitting with him to keep him from crying. Unfortunately, the sand was blocking his digestive system and it was a waiting game to see if it resolved (as surgery was not ideal). Pip sent us home for the night with everything we needed - we felt prepared and confident in her guidance. The next day, despite being the only vet on duty and fully booked, Pip and the team got Denny in again for an Xray inbetween appointments. As we weren't out of the woods yet, Pip and her dedicated team made another slot available for Denny on Monday to see how things were going. Thankfully, Denny's blockage had resolved. On more than one occasion this weekend, we found ourselves saying how thankful we were for the team at North Perth Veterinary Centre. Even when the outcome seamed impossible, we knew that decisions were being made in Dennys best interests - no matter how hard it may have been to hear. This is not the first time Pip and the team have been there for Denny and thanks to their efforts and dedication, it won't be the last.
